To provide the most accurate and helpful rankings, our tier list considers several critical factors. All units are evaluated based on their EVO version at max level, assuming high-end stats and optimal traits and gear. This ensures that the rankings reflect a unit’s true potential in competitive play.
Here’s a breakdown of what each tier signifies:
- S-Tier: These are the meta-defining units, offering unparalleled DPS (Damage Per Second) or exceptional utility. They are essential for tackling the toughest challenges and form the backbone of any top-tier team.
- A-Tier: Great alternatives that perform just below S-Tier units. They can significantly contribute to your team’s power and are often excellent choices if you don’t have S-Tier options readily available.
- B-Tier: Decent DPS units that are usable but may require more strategic placement or support to shine. They are solid mid-game choices and can help bridge the gap to higher-tier units.
- C-Tier: Primarily beginner units that are useful in the early to mid-game but should be replaced as you acquire stronger options. Player experience suggests avoiding heavy investment in their trait rerolls, as those resources are better saved for Mythic and Secret rarity units.
- D-Tier: This tier encompasses most Epic and Rare units (with a few exceptions). They are quickly outclassed by higher-rarity units and should not receive significant investment in traits or upgrades.
Special Unit Acquisition Notes:
- Ymir: Acquired from Legend Stage 3, typically requiring 150 Pity. You must finish the main story to unlock LS3.
- Crimson Knight: Obtained by farming the Igris Boss Event.
S-Tier Units: The Unrivaled Powerhouses of Anime Destiny
These S-Tier units represent the pinnacle of power in Anime Destiny. Integrating them into your team will significantly boost your chances of success in various game modes due to their exceptional damage, utility, and overall impact.
| Unit Name | Rarity | Ranking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Frozen Moon (Kizuki) | Secret | Top utility DPS with freeze and shield-breaking value. |
| Founding Titan (Queen) | Secret | Summon-based carry with strong boss pressure. |
| Shadow Monarch (Awaken) | Secret | Meta summoner with Crimson Knight synergy. |
| Ashura Swordsman (3SS) | Mythic | High Mythic DPS and shield-break potential. |
| Crimson Knight (Dark) | Secret | Strong DPS and important Shadow Monarch partner. |
| Red Emperor (Haki) | Mythic | One of the strongest Mythic damage options. |
